From an ecological standpoint, a spike in gray whale deaths is a major sentinel sign of an Arctic ecosystem collapse driven by rapid climate warming. Because gray whales are highly sensitive to changes in ocean conditions, scientists view them as "canaries in the coal mine" for the health of the entire Pacific Ocean and Arctic food webs.
